What is fieldvu?
FieldVU is a field service management solution for small and medium businesses. In addition to management tools, it also offers various accounting and business intelligence services. The software was designed and launched by VistaVU Solutions, Inc., headquartered in Calgary, Canada.Who is it best for?
Customers of the software mainly come from small and medium businesses. Industries where it has been mainly deployed include construction, automation, manufacturing, software development, and government sector. Some noteworthy customers of the software include such names as Black Diamond Group, Industrial Battery Products, and Datalog Technology Inc. etc.Main features and functionalities
Core features of the software include billing & invoicing, business intelligence, customer management, project management, resource management, and scheduling & routing. - FieldVU offers real time visibility into job and unit costing, field tracking and other important domains.
- The software can be integrated with various third party tools and solutions such as SAP Business One.
- FieldVU offers detailed and customizable labor sheet for capturing working hours for every employee.
Cons
- Core features of FieldVU do not include work order management and quoting & estimating.
- The software does not offer scheduling features of GPS tracking and recurring scheduling.
